- Mile-a-minute weed detected in Michigan -- what to know about the invasive vine
Mile-a-minute weed, a fast-growing invasive vine that smothers vegetation, was detected in Jackson County, Michigan. The vine, first found in the state in 2020, grows up to 25 feet in weeks and threatens tree seedlings, orchards, and restoration areas. It spreads via bird-dispersed berries and requires manual removal and monitoring.
